Dear [Neighbor's Name], I hope this letter finds you well. I am writing to discuss an important matter regarding the cleanliness of your yard, which has been causing some concerns for our community. As a caring and responsible neighbor, I believe it is crucial for all of us to maintain the appearance and hygiene of our properties to ensure a pleasant living environment. Firstly, I want to acknowledge that we all lead busy lives, and it can be challenging to find time for yard maintenance. However, an unkempt yard not only diminishes the visual appeal of our street but can also attract pests and pose health risks to our families and pets. As per Pennsylvania state regulations and our neighborhood's guidelines, property owners are required to maintain their yards in a clean, weed-free, and well-maintained condition. This includes regularly mowing the lawn, trimming overgrown vegetation, removing debris, and keeping the property free from any accumulated garbage or litter. Unfortunately, over the past few weeks, your yard appears to have fallen behind in terms of upkeep. Tall grass, untrimmed bushes, and scattered branches have become noticeable eyesores. Additionally, the presence of stagnant water in containers may become a breeding ground for mosquitoes and other insects, posing health hazards to our community. Apart from the aesthetic concerns, I am also worried about the potential negative impact on property values. A well-maintained neighborhood tends to have higher market appeal, benefiting all homeowners in the area. Therefore, it is essential that we address this matter promptly to uphold the value and desirability of our community. I kindly request that you take the necessary steps to clean and maintain your yard as soon as possible. This could involve trimming the grass and bushes, removing any debris, emptying water containers, and keeping your property in compliance with the local regulations. If you are experiencing difficulties or need any assistance, please feel free to reach out to me. As neighbors, we should support each other, and I am more than willing to lend a helping hand if required. Furthermore, I encourage you to explore local services and resources that can aid in yard maintenance if you are unable to manage it yourself. In conclusion, I believe that by collectively taking responsibility for our yards, we can enhance the overall appearance, value, and quality of our neighborhood. Let us work together to maintain a clean and inviting living environment for everyone to enjoy. Thank you for your attention to this matter, and I appreciate your cooperation in addressing the concerns raised. I look forward to seeing positive changes in the near future. How to handle bad neighbors Call ahead and pick a time to talk. Meet on the sidewalk or on the property line. Don't accuse; let them know how the problem bothers you and suggest ways to solve it together. If that doesn't work, check out local noise and disturbance ordinances and write a personal letter.
